In a classroom of 14-30+ students, teachers must pace instruction to meet the needs of the whole group, which can leave some students behind or unchallenged. Personalized 1-on-1 tutoring allows a tutor to adjust pacing, teaching methods, and content in real time based on how the student is responding. Tutors can spend extra time on difficult concepts, skip material the student has already mastered, and use examples and explanations that match the student's interests and learning style.
